What is InfiniBand Architecture?
InfiniBand Architecture is an industry standard, channel-based, switched fabric, interconnect architecture for servers. InfiniBand architecture changes the way servers are built, deployed, and managed.
Why is InfiniBand Architecture important?
As processor speeds increase with Moore's Law and the Internet drives the demand for constantly available data, the biggest gate to improved data center performance is the I/O subsystem. InfiniBand Architecture provides a blueprint for significantly improved solution performance and increased availability to meet the needs of the Internet. InfiniBand Architecture is designed to fulfill the need for greater data center reliability, availability and scalability, as well as greater design density for InfiniBand architecture enabled servers.
What performance range is offered by the InfiniBand Architecture specifications?
InfiniBand Architecture offers three levels of link performance - 2.5 Gbits, 10 Gbits, and 30 Gbits/sec. InfiniBand Architecture also enables low latency communication within the fabric enabling higher aggregate throughput than traditional standards-based protocols. This uniquely positions InfiniBand Architecture as the I/O interconnect for data centers.
What will it take to integrate InfiniBand Architecture into a data center?
InfiniBand Architecture is expected to be implemented with existing data center implementations through connectivity into the InfiniBand fabric. Initial server implementations are expected to include InfiniBand Host Channel Adapters deployed on PCI adapter cards. As the technology evolves, native InfiniBand implementations are expected with a broad base of interoperable products from member companies. How will InfiniBand fabrics be managed?
The InfiniBand Architecture specifications have standardized InfiniBand management infrastructure. InfiniBand fabrics will be managed via InfiniBand consoles and InfiniBand fabric management is expected to snap into existing enterprise management solutions.
How big is the InfiniBand Architecture development effort?
The InfiniBand Trade Association has grown from 7 companies to more than 190 since its launch in August, 1999. Membership is open to any company, department of government or academic institution interested in the development of InfiniBand architecture. How does InfiniBand Architecture relate to 3rd Generation I/O technology (3GIO)?
The technologies are complimentary. InfiniBand Architecture was designed from the ground up to address the specific needs of data centers. In the server market, 3GIO is expected to be an inside the box interconnect, or local I/O.
